Maple Leafs assign Marshall Rifai to Toronto Marlies on conditioning loan
Marshall Rifai has been loaned to the Toronto Marlies on a conditioning loan, the Maple Leafs announced Thursday.

The 27-year-old recorded three goals and 13 points in 63 games with the Marlies last season. Rifai’s physicality, tenacity and ability to defend at the net-front are all qualities that head coach Craig Berube seeks from his defence corps, and he could be an asset for the Maple Leafs’ going forward, with Brandon Carlo out indefinitely.

“He had some games up with us last year and he worked so hard,”Maple Leafs captain Auston Matthews said about Rifai during last year’s training camp. “You can just see he wants it and continues to progress, and I’ve been pretty impressed with him and the way he plays hard on both sides of the puck.”

The conditioning loan indicates that Rifai ought to be close to returning, and it’s possible he could be deployed Christmas. Toronto squares off against the Washington Capitals on Thursday, the first game of a three-game road trip, and it’s entirely possible he gets called up during this span.
